Gainesville, Georgia by the numbers
- Gas current price: $3.67
--- Georgia average: $3.75
- Week change: -$0.06 (-1.5%)
- Year change: +$0.80 (+27.7%)
- Historical expensive gas price: $4.50 (6/14/22)

Stacker compiled statistics on gas prices in Gainesville, GA metro area using data from AAA. Gas prices are current as of June 15.

- Diesel current price: $4.78
- Week change: -$0.08 (-1.6%)
- Year change: +$1.33 (+38.5%)
- Historical expensive diesel price: $5.51 (6/11/22)
